Плохой рендеринг нестандартных шрифтов в Chrome на Windows - PullRequest
10 голосов
/ 22 января 2012

Я уверен, что это обсуждалось ранее, но я не могу найти какой-либо канонический вопрос / ответ.

В настоящее время IE9 и Firefox 4+ используют различный рендеринг шрифтов, который производит (для некоторых) большеразмытые шрифты, но в целом лучше кернинг и более стабильные результаты.Кроме того, он значительно лучше отображает нестандартные шрифты в Windows.Я не провел тщательного расследования, но я думаю, что это связано с тем, что и IE9, и Firefox теперь используют разные графические слои, которые, по-видимому, отображают шрифты по-разному.Кроме того, причина того, что некоторые стандартные шрифты, такие как Arial, Tahoma и т. Д., Выглядят в Firefox так же, как и 10 лет назад, заключается в том, что он фактически имеет список исключений для них (ищите gfx.font_rendering.cleartype_params.force_gdi_classic_for_families).

Все идет нормально.Проблема в Chrome.Он по-прежнему использует старый рендеринг шрифтов, что делает нестандартные шрифты практически непригодными.Просто для иллюстрации, шрифт, который я имел в виду: http://www.google.com/webfonts/specimen/Play. Просто откройте образец в Firefox / IE9 и Chrome, и вы увидите разницу.Что я могу сделать?Или я должен искать более оптимизированный шрифт.

Обновление: Я вижу, что это распространенная проблема: заголовки на http://www.smashingmagazine.com выглядят очень хромыми в Chrome.

Обновление: Образец изображения:

Sample image

Ответы [ 3 ]

2 голосов
/ 09 февраля 2012

Я читал, что в Chrome (изначально Chromium) есть проблемы сглаживания, поэтому он работает некорректно.Использование font-face также имеет значение, чем использование локальных шрифтов в вашей системе.Итак, все, что мы можем сделать, это просто подождать, пока они решат эту проблему или помочь Chromium Project, если вы можете.

1 голос
/ 20 января 2013

Известная проблема . Вы можете попробовать gdipp или MacType .

0 голосов
/ 20 июля 2012

Копирование моего ответа из Улучшение рендеринга шрифтов CSS3 @ font-face в ClearType для Windows

Аналогичный вопрос здесь: Внешний вид встроенных шрифтовнечетко в браузерах Windows 7 получил ответ, который решил ту же проблему для меня.

Генератор шрифтов fontsquirrel http://www.fontsquirrel.com/fontface/generator оптимизирует шрифты и добавляет их с подсказкой / информацией рендеринга, которая помогает шрифту Windowsрендеринг движок рендерит их лучше.Он также генерирует файлы меньшего размера, которые загружаются быстрее.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...